These yurts and cabins are situated in a beautiful setting, right in the canyon. It's very scenic, and you get to hike on trails to your yurt or cabin as there isn't driving or parking access. There is a neat little bar and deck where you can have a local beer after your adventures. Everyone was very friendly. We arrived a few minutes before the 4pm check in and were told that our yurt wasn't ready yet. We had to wait for about 40 minutes before we could get checked in. If you stay here in the fall be sure to bring extra bedding since the night will be COLD and they may not have put the heaters in the yurt yet. Also bring earplugs because I-70 is just a few yards away and traffic runs day and night. It's kind of a trade-off: affordable and in a beautiful setting, but not well temperature controlled and very noisy.
